Johan Vromans presents a concise guide that serves as an essential companion for Perl programmers. This pocket reference is designed for quick consultations and practical use, highlighting key aspects of Perl's syntax and features. It offers clarity and accessibility, making it a handy tool for both novices and seasoned developers facing Perl-related challenges.

Within its compact format, readers can easily navigate through topics, ensuring they can find the information they need without sifting through extensive manuals. Its portability means it can be taken anywhere, allowing users to enhance their coding skills on the go.

Overall, this reference stands out for its focus on practical applications over theory, empowering programmers to apply Perl effectively in their projects. Its careful curation of essential information makes it a must-have in any developer's toolkit.
